AEW World Tag Team Championship Match: FTR (c) Vs. Big Bill & Brian Cage

The night kicked off with FTR defending their tag team titles against Big Bill and Brian Cage. The match was hard-hitting and fast-paced, with both teams showcasing their skills. FTR ultimately retained their titles, solidifying their status as one of the top tag teams in AEW.

AEW TBS Title Match: Kris Statlander (c) Vs. Mercedes Martinez

In the TBS Championship match, Kris Statlander put her title on the line against Mercedes Martinez. The match was a hard-fought battle, with both competitors giving it their all. In the end, Statlander showed why she is the champion, successfully retaining her title.

Samoa Joe vs. Serpentico

ROH Television Champion Samoa Joe made an appearance, taking on Serpentico in a quick match. Joe made quick work of his opponent, securing a submission victory in just 10 seconds.

AEW World Trios Championship Match: The House of Black (c) Vs. Darius Martin, Action Andretti, Lee Johnson

The House of Black defended their trios titles against Darius Martin, Action Andretti, and Lee Johnson. The match was a showcase of high-flying moves and teamwork, but The House of Black proved to be too dominant, retaining their championships.

Metalik vs. Jay White

Metalik made his “Collision” debut, facing off against Jay White. The match was intense, with both competitors displaying their in-ring skills. In the end, White emerged victorious, solidifying his status as a top contender in AEW.

Real AEW World Championship Match: CM Punk (c) Vs. Ricky Starks

The main event of the evening featured CM Punk defending his “real” world championship against Ricky Starks. The match was a back-and-forth battle, with both competitors showcasing their athleticism and determination. In the end, Punk managed to retain his title, but not without controversy. Starks attacked the referee and Punk had to chase him out of the arena.
